Streaming 6pr (was Re: [plug] windows - a rant)

Bennett, Phillip PBennett at arg.net.au
Tue May 11 09:35:53 WST 2004


Trevor Phillips wrote:
| On Friday 07 May 2004 13:56, Garry wrote:
|
|>Does your mplayer work with  http://6pr.com.au/live.asx ?
|>I get:
|>
|>- --snip--
|>Connecting to server 6pr.com.au[203.30.44.22]:80 ...
|>size_confirm mismatch!: 22611 28271
|>Error while parsing chunk header
|>Unknown protocol: http
|>asf_streaming_start failed
|>Unable to open URL: http://6pr.com.au/live.asx
|>Option stream url: This URL doesn't have a hostname part.
|>File not found: 'live.asx'
|>Failed to open http://6pr.com.au/live.asx
|>
|>Obviously i'm missing a codec or somming..
|
|
| I got it to work - but not quite as easily as that - but not very hard
either.
|
| After a similar failure, I went:
|   wget http://6pr.com.au/live.asx
|   cat live.asx
| picked out the <ENTRY> <REF HREF=....> URL, and then:
|   mplayer http://203.30.47.38/6pr
|
| Which, after a while buffering, started playing fine.
|
| This is on a Debian Testing system, with those Marillat packages,
including
| the w32codecs package.
|
| My experience is a lot of these streaming formats start with a meta
file, so
| if you just wget them, you can often rummage around inside for the
next URL
| to try. Why mplayer can't do this itself I'm not sure...
|

>EXCELLENT! Works a beauty, thanks Trevor.
>
>Regards
>
>Garry

I'm not so sure mplayer can't do this...  I typed in 'mplayer
http://6pr.com.au/live.asx' and it just worked! :)

The only problem I DID have was that it was taking a while to fill the
buffer (Default 8MB).  I took it down to 140KB and it works fine without
skipping or anything.  I tried a few different levels to get the best
result, and this turned out OK.  Also tried this with the triplej stream and
it's great!

Here's the output for those interested:

[bman at Holly mplayer]# mplayer http://6pr.com.au/live.asx

<cut out the codec and remote control stuff etc...>

Playing http://6pr.com.au/live.asx.
Resolving 6pr.com.au for AF_INET...
Connecting to server 6pr.com.au[203.30.44.22]:80 ...
Resolving 6pr.com.au for AF_INET...
Connecting to server 6pr.com.au[203.30.44.22]:80 ...
Connected to server: 6pr.com.au


Playing http://203.30.47.38/6pr.
Connecting to server 203.30.47.38[203.30.47.38]:80 ...
Connecting to server 203.30.47.38[203.30.47.38]:80 ...
Stream bitrate properties object
Max bandwidth set to 0
Connecting to server 203.30.47.38[203.30.47.38]:80 ...
Cache size set to 140 KBytes
Connected to server: 203.30.47.38
Cache fill:  5.71% (8192 bytes)

That's it. :)

Phil. 
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.plug.org.au/pipermail/plug/attachments/20040511/b4f5734a/attachment.html>


More information about the plug mailing list